About this appearance
A softer, more personal CBS Sunday Morning segment profiling Musk during peak Boring Company hype. Lee Cowan toured the Hawthorne HQ and test tunnel, and the interview touched on work-life balance, Musk's management style, and his children. One of the few interviews where Musk discussed his childhood in South Africa with any depth, describing being bullied and his escape into books and computers.

Memorable moments
Describes being beaten up as a child in South Africa to the point of hospitalization: 'I was a nerdy kid who read too much and got thrown down stairs by bullies.'
Demonstrates the Boring Company test tunnel by driving Lee Cowan through it in a Tesla — one of the earliest media rides through the tunnel.
Admits he works 80-90 hours per week and hasn't taken a vacation in years: 'I'm not really trying to be a role model here. I don't recommend it.'
